The reorganized national health service | Author(s) | Ruth Levitt, Andrew Wall, John Appleby |
Publisher | Chapman & Hall, London, 1995 |
Pages | 299 pp |
Source | International Thomson Publishing Services Ltd, Cheriton House, North Way, Andover, Hampshire SP10 5BE. |
Keywords | National Health Service. |
Annotation | Presents an analysis of developments in management structures, the organisation of professional work, and services for patients. Topics covered include the purchaser and provider roles, needs assessment, finance and the Patient's Charter. |
